There seems to be a huge variation in the online and offline prices for various brands. There is a retailer around the corner , who is offering to "match" online prices for certain Sony and Samsung models , all of which cost more than what I intend/want to spend on a TV.
Not sure if I should take the plunge and order online or basically pay about 10-15% more to get it from a shop.

For example this Panasonic 40" is being sold for 33k online, and about 38k offline.

This Sony is 47k online, 50.5 offline.
Am I looking at the wrong shops in Pune ?

Watch out, you may not get the Flexi mount Bracket along with the TV if you ordered online which will cost about 1500-2000 rs on the other hand if you get it from the Store you will get this as well as the 1 Year extended warranty.

Check out Multiple Stores before buying and bargain with them based on the Online Price, hopefully you will get the Best price !
